IBR sheets 686 mm

Sheet metal IBR 686 mm with thickness 0.3 mm - 0.8 mm Painted and Unpainted (Z100 and AZ150)

Description:

IBR is a sheet with a trapezoidal angled folded profile. Its strong appearance makes it attractive and practical. Since IBR was introduced to the South African market in 1958, it has become the most popular used in the construction of commercial and industrial buildings. IBR is an abbreviation for "inverted reinforced box". The number " 686" stands for the effective widths of the cover plates. The general shape and appearance of the trapezoidal grooves ensure that the Alteza 686 IBR sheet is entirely acceptable for use as roofing and cladding wall. The deep and wide grooves of the Alteza 686 type IBR sheet ensure excellent drainage characteristics.
